A “worldview” is:
“a particular philosophy of life or conception of the world”
-Google
“the fundamental cognitive orientation of an individual or
society encompassing the entirety of the individual or
society's knowledge and point of view. A world view can
include natural philosophy; fundamental, existential, and
normative postulates; or themes, values, emotions, and
ethics.” -Wikipedia

“"[It's] any ideology, philosophy, theology, movement or
religion that provides an overarching approach to
understanding God, the world and man's relations to God
and the world" -David Noebel, Understanding the Times
“A worldview is the framework from which we view reality
and make sense of life and the world. -Del Tackett, FOTF
““The sum total of a person’s beliefs about the world.”
-Chuck Colson
“the lens through which a person sees the world”

A set of belief statements,
assumed or accepted as true,
by which we subconsciously
interpret everything around us
which then become the basis
for our thoughts, values,
attitudes, and actions.

What are the core
belief statements
about?
The nature of God
Man
Life’s Purpose
Morality: Right and Wrong
The World and Nature
Death

How does a worldview
get developed?
Family
Socially: school, church,
friends
Life Experiences
MEDIA: TV, movies, music,
commercials, Internet
